Definition

  1. 1
    das Nichtaufhören

Recorded use

Wiktionary example

These source excerpts show how Fortdauer app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.

  1. „Der Seitenumfang des Kommunal-Kalenders wuchs mit Fortdauer des Erscheinens immer weiter an; 1917 hatte er nahezu 1.400 Seiten.“
